lostyazilim
tr.link

MySQLi & PDO sizce hangisi?

17 Mesajlar 2.698 Okunma
lstbozum
tr.link

    cihaneken cihaneken Üyeliği Durdurulmuş Banlı Kullanıcı
    • Üyelik 25.07.2014
    • Yaş/Cinsiyet 30 / E
    • Meslek Elektrik Teknisyeni
    • Konum Fransa
    • Ad Soyad C** E**
    • Mesajlar 3508
    • Beğeniler 488 / 1190
    • Ticaret 1, (%100)
    Merhaba arkadaşlar
    Ben PHP konusunda kendimi daha fazla ilerletmek istiyorum, uzun zamandır pek çalışma yapmamıştım fakat tekrar bazı çalışmalara başlamayı düşünüyorum.
    Sizlere sorum şu olacak yeni bir projede ileriye dönük olarak düşündüğümüzde yapacağımız çalışmalarda siz olsanız hangisini tercih ederdiniz ve nedenleriniz ne olurdu?
     

     

    wmaraci
    reklam

    monelogg monelogg <> Kullanıcı
    • Üyelik 06.03.2014
    • Yaş/Cinsiyet 33 / E
    • Meslek Öğrenci
    • Konum Diğer
    • Ad Soyad M** B**
    • Mesajlar 658
    • Beğeniler 78 / 125
    • Ticaret 0, (%0)
    Şahsen PDO derim, hem güvenlik mysqli'den aşağı kalır yanı yok bildiğim kadarıyla, hem de farklı veri tabanlarını da destekliyor. mysqli ile prosedürel programlama da yapılabiliyor ama nesne yönelimli kullanmak daha iyi olur düşüncesindeyim.
     

     

    cihaneken cihaneken Üyeliği Durdurulmuş Banlı Kullanıcı
    • Üyelik 25.07.2014
    • Yaş/Cinsiyet 30 / E
    • Meslek Elektrik Teknisyeni
    • Konum Fransa
    • Ad Soyad C** E**
    • Mesajlar 3508
    • Beğeniler 488 / 1190
    • Ticaret 1, (%100)
    monelogg yorumun için teşekkür ederim. Peki hız konusunda ne düşünüyorsun? MySQLi daha hızlı olduğu düşünülüyor senin fikrin var mı bu konuda?
     

     

    monelogg monelogg <> Kullanıcı
    • Üyelik 06.03.2014
    • Yaş/Cinsiyet 33 / E
    • Meslek Öğrenci
    • Konum Diğer
    • Ad Soyad M** B**
    • Mesajlar 658
    • Beğeniler 78 / 125
    • Ticaret 0, (%0)
    cihaneken rica ederim, mysqli biraz daha hızlı ama bildiğim kadarıyla önemli bir fark yok, hız çok çok önemli ise kullanılabilir ama tam da bilmiyorum yalan olmasın. :)
    cihaneken

    kişi bu mesajı beğendi.

    wmaraci
    wmaraci

    47003 47003 WM Aracı Anonim Üyelik
    • Üyelik 12.03.2015
    • Yaş/Cinsiyet - /
    • Meslek
    • Konum
    • Ad Soyad ** **
    • Mesajlar 576
    • Beğeniler 46 / 205
    • Ticaret 16, (%100)
    PDO diyorum
    cihaneken

    kişi bu mesajı beğendi.

    cihaneken cihaneken Üyeliği Durdurulmuş Banlı Kullanıcı
    • Üyelik 25.07.2014
    • Yaş/Cinsiyet 30 / E
    • Meslek Elektrik Teknisyeni
    • Konum Fransa
    • Ad Soyad C** E**
    • Mesajlar 3508
    • Beğeniler 488 / 1190
    • Ticaret 1, (%100)
    Winston teşekkürler. Peki PDO seçmenizde ki sebepler neler?
     

     

    47003 47003 WM Aracı Anonim Üyelik
    • Üyelik 12.03.2015
    • Yaş/Cinsiyet - /
    • Meslek
    • Konum
    • Ad Soyad ** **
    • Mesajlar 576
    • Beğeniler 46 / 205
    • Ticaret 16, (%100)

    cihaneken adlı üyeden alıntı

    Winston teşekkürler. Peki PDO seçmenizde ki sebepler neler?


    Birden çok veritabanı yapısını destekliyor, SQL açıkları konusunda daha iyi gibi ve try catch hataları daha mantıklı diyebilirim.
    cihaneken

    kişi bu mesajı beğendi.

    ismail03 ismail03 WM Aracı Kullanıcı
    • Üyelik 28.11.2013
    • Yaş/Cinsiyet 30 / E
    • Meslek Ameliyathane Hemşiresi
    • Konum Afyon
    • Ad Soyad I** Ç**
    • Mesajlar 2633
    • Beğeniler 344 / 487
    • Ticaret 12, (%100)
    PDO
    ->Try catch
    ->Hata yakalama Detay
    ->Mysqli tek Mysql çalıştırırken PDO uyumlu olduğu 9 (yanlış olmasın öle hatırlıyorum) Sql sorgusu işleyebiliyor
    ->PDO daha güvenli geldi bana
    cihaneken

    kişi bu mesajı beğendi.

    Yeninesil44 Yeninesil44 Kullanıcı
    • Üyelik 28.02.2015
    • Yaş/Cinsiyet 34 / E
    • Meslek web programlama
    • Konum Malatya
    • Ad Soyad O** D**
    • Mesajlar 1033
    • Beğeniler 282 / 281
    • Ticaret 18, (%100)
    MYsql ulan :D
    herkes pdo bende mysql olsun madem

    mysql veya pdo cokta önemli degil ben ilk baslarda pdo kullanıordum sora mysql gectim pek bişe farketmedim bu 2sinin hızına vs takmana gerek yok googleden saglam veritabanı classı bulabilirsiniz kendine göre veya githubdan mesela ben symfony kullanıorum driver a mysql veya pdo yazmam yeterli oluor fonksionlar da bi degisiklik olmuo sizde böle bi sistem oturtabilirsiniz kendinize
     

     

    MultiAnaliz.com

    cihaneken cihaneken Üyeliği Durdurulmuş Banlı Kullanıcı
    • Üyelik 25.07.2014
    • Yaş/Cinsiyet 30 / E
    • Meslek Elektrik Teknisyeni
    • Konum Fransa
    • Ad Soyad C** E**
    • Mesajlar 3508
    • Beğeniler 488 / 1190
    • Ticaret 1, (%100)
    Yeninesil44 bende mysqli kullanmaya başladım, açıkcası PDO biraz karmaşık geldi gözüme ve o hengabeye girmemek için en azında kullanım olarak myslq'a olan benzerliği nedeni ile ve kolay kullanacağımı düşündüğüm için mysqli tercih ettim.
     

     

    Site Ayarları
    • Tema Seçeneği
    • Site Sesleri
    • Bildirimler
    • Özel Mesaj Al